July 11, 2014
Sidley, Kirkland Put Under Microscope In EFH Bankruptcy
The trustee for second-lien noteholders owed $1.6 billion in the Energy Future Holdings Corp. bankruptcy is pressing ahead with plans to scrutinize the debtors' counsel Kirkland & Ellis LLP and Sidley Austin LLP over any past ties with the equity holders that bought out the energy giant in 2007, according to court papers filed Friday.

July 09, 2014
Energy Future Pushes Back Hearing On $1.9B DIP
Bankrupt power giant Energy Future Holdings Corp. has postponed a contested hearing over a $1.9 billion debtor-in-possession facility and a related settlement previously slated to resume Thursday, as well as consideration of a plan support agreement scheduled for next week, saying it needs time to consider comments from the court and other issues.

July 08, 2014
Creditors Slam Energy Future's 'Extremely Limited' Records
Creditors of Energy Future Holdings Corp. on Tuesday complained that the Texas power giant has been slacking in its production of documents surrounding its bankruptcy, saying Energy Future needs to pick up the pace so creditors have enough time to evaluate their potential claims.

June 30, 2014
Energy Future, Creditors Spar Over $1.9B DIP Loan
Power giant Energy Future Holdings Corp. urged a Delaware bankruptcy judge on Monday to bless a $1.9 billion debtor-in-possession facility and a settlement with junior noteholders, drawing fire from an array of creditors involved in the mammoth Chapter 11 case.

June 26, 2014
Energy Future Creditors Want 3rd Circ. To Review $4B Deal
Senior noteholders of Energy Future Holdings Corp. urged a Delaware bankruptcy judge on Wednesday to fast-track their appeal of a settlement that repaid $4 billion in first-lien bonds, saying the "unprecedented" structure of the power giant's deal required prompt handling by the Third Circuit.

June 24, 2014
EFH Noteholders Object To $1.9B DIP Plan
A group of unsecured noteholders of Energy Future Holdings Corp. on Tuesday urged a New York bankruptcy judge to reject the power company's request for approval of a $1.9 billion debtor-in-possession facility to pay off second-lien notes issued by a subsidiary, arguing the plan vastly undervalues the debtors.

June 23, 2014
EFH Senior Bondholders Sue Junior Group To Protect $432M
Senior bondholders of an Energy Future Holdings Inc. affiliate on Friday filed papers contending that junior bondholders cannot be paid out of the senior group's collateral proceeds unless the senior bondholders receive $432.4 million they say they are owed.

June 17, 2014
Energy Future Bondholders Seek Make-Whole On $2.2B Refi
Junior bondholders of Energy Future Holdings Corp. launched an adversary suit in Delaware bankruptcy court Monday claiming the power company's plan to refinance nearly $2.2 billion in notes entitles them hundreds of millions of dollars in make-whole payments.

June 11, 2014
Energy Future Bondholders Urge Judge To Stall Key Deal
A group of Energy Future Holdings Corp. bondholders on Wednesday urged a Delaware federal judge to temporarily halt the implementation of a deal that the group says would allow other bondholders an unfair boost in recovery on their claims.

June 10, 2014
Energy Future Seeks OK On $11M Texas Tax-Refund Deal
Electricity giant Energy Future Holdings Corp. asked a Delaware bankruptcy court on Monday to approve an $11.3 million settlement between its Texas subsidiary, TXU Energy Retail Company LLC, and the Texas comptroller, saying the settlement would boost strained customer relations and prevent future litigation over the company's tax credit claims.
